This commit is contained in:
mwiegand 2021-11-14 21:51:37 +01:00
parent 942d7becf8
commit e17d92448a

View file

@ -5,17 +5,14 @@ from functools import cache
from subprocess import check_output
import json
app = Flask(__name__)
app.secret_key = environ.get("FLASK_SECRET_KEY", default='test')
@app.route('/', methods = ['GET'])
def build():
strategy = request.args.get('strategy')
hook_data = request.get_json()
print(hook_data)
return check_output([f'/opt/build_server/strategies/{strategy}', json.dumps(hook_data)])
return check_output([f'/opt/build-server/strategies/{strategy}', json.dumps(hook_data)])
if __name__ =='__main__':